Output 12559703566fa579a9fb0dbb3d4890464ead3f2390c091e786b85d889821d66b:0

value
345000
script pubkey
OP_0 OP_PUSHBYTES_20 70b5a80ad2c9fbe8fcaccc9c3fec8408c94d004d
address
bc1qwz66szkje8a73l9vejwrlmyypry56qzd0nzv44
transaction
12559703566fa579a9fb0dbb3d4890464ead3f2390c091e786b85d889821d66b
spent
true